C语言
2015-09-05 18:10
246 查看
2015年08月04日
//3、编写函数,返回三个随机整数[10,30]的中间数。
//方法二:三个数的和减去最大值和最小值,即得到中间值
intmedium = 0 ,max = 0,min = 0;
//找到最大值
max =a>b?a:b;
max = max>c?max:c;
//找到最小值
min = a
min = min
medium =(a+b+c)-max-min;
return medium;}
//编写函数,返回正整数n中的数字的个数。
int numberOfNum(int num){
int count =1; // 计数器
while (num/10){
count++;
num=num/10;
}
return count;
}
相关文章推荐
- C语言
- C语言基础
- C++面试常见题目问与答(汇总二)
- C语言实现二叉树
- C++和C语言相互调用-【写得非常好】
- 关于C++引用的一些注意点
- C++入门经典 笔记 (第十七章)使用多态和派生类
- C语言基础知识之(二十):指针高级运用
- C++ 多继承和虚继承的内存布局(Memory Layout for Multiple and Virtual Inheritance )
- C++ DateTime 结构
- C++和C语言混编
- 小解C++模板特化
- c语言之单链表的创建及排序
- C++中的类拷贝构造函数和模板拷贝构造函数
- POJ C++程序设计 编程题#1 List
- C++模板学习之单链表的实现
- 考虑用赋值运算符(op=)取代其单独形式(op)(More Effective C++_22(效率))
- c++primer之顺序容器(添加元素)
- operator new在C++中的各种写法
- C++11 区间迭代